What is the definition of refraction, luminescence, and ultraviolet?

Respuesta :

DeathTheKid101 DeathTheKid101
  • 12-05-2017
Refraction- bending of light waves (ex. straw in a cup of water looks bent on a side but really is NOT, this is due to refraction, it bends the light waves reflected)

Luminescence- Creation/Emission/Starting or making of light through ways that DO NOT INVOLVE heat.

Ultraviolet- a wavelength that is part of the electromagnetic spectrum its shorter than visible light waves.
